The fact that you’re going with electric rather than petrol is going to be a big step in the right direction when it comes to helping the environment. Those petrol guzzling machines of days gone by were well known for emitting both noise and toxin pollution.

Those with a passion for the perfect lawn may find themselves wanting to cut their lawns more than once a week, in particular if they are entering events such as Britain’s Best Lawn competition run by lawnmower manufacturers Briggs & Statton.

A side effect of having the greener lawn is that it will be less green. Take that either way that you read it, but the bottom line is that if you add chemicals to improve its shade of green, then you’ll be crossing the line into the potentially environmentally damaging arena.

Lawns add a lot when it comes to practical support for the environment. For example, they don’t do a whole lot for other species in nature, but they can stabilise soils and provide somewhere visually pleasant for us to enjoy looking at, walking on or sitting on.

Investing in either a corded or cordless electric lawn mower is a great step in the right direction towards being environmentally responsible. We think that either of the different electric powered lawn mower types offer excellent cutting, but our preference might be to sway slightly more towards the cordless now that the lithium battery has been so well developed.

Lithium batteries are now recognised as being 30% more efficient than they used to be and compared to older style gel battery equipped cordless mowers, weigh 40% less. With regular use you can expect to enjoy 10 years of battery life from them.
